Data provided on both level and twist of vehicle; 4-point control of all leveling actuators, fully automatic or manual; Reduces air consumption by up to 85%, saving power and fuel; Combined chassis-height and tilt sensing reduces air leveling time; Slope indicator warns when terrain is too steep for leveling Obsolete Manual Leveling From 1994 until 2005, some Power Gear leveling systems utilized a manual leveling control system. The original controls were in use from 1994 until 1999, with updated versions of these controls used from 2000 until 2005. These manual controls are now obsolete and replaced with manual leveling control kit # 1010001131 ...Once the rear jacks are on the ground, level the coach using the carpenters level. After front to rear is achieved, turn the level 90° and level the coach from side to side using the "LEFT" and "RIGHT" buttons. NOTE: Recheck front to rear level after completing side to side leveling. The Power Gear leveling and stabilizing system is an electronically. controlled/hydraulically operated unit that consists of a 12 volt DC powered. motor/pump/manifold assembly with fluid reservoir, hydraulic hoses, four. hydraulically operated jacks and a control unit with switch panel. Press the AUTO button to automatically level the coach. Verify that: • Jacks are dropped to the ground • Selected jacks are then extended to level the coach. • When auto level is complete, the coach has returned to the programmed level zero point. The green Power Gear LED in the center of the leveling buttons should be illuminated.I have a 2000 Fleetwood discovery with power gear jacks. Jacks stopped working. I have checked all fuses. Depending on the age of your Power Gear system, the older systems had the fuses (Special Round) located on the bottom of the keypad. Later versions have a control box under the dash, and uses regular auto fuses.
